The power transfomer,with complex sturcture and high fault rate,is one of the most important equipments in power system.The safe operation is the foundation of the safe and stable operation of the power system.In recent years, artificial immune technology is a hotspot in intelligent technology research.The artificial immune technology has its own characteristics and advantages in the application of fault diagnosis. This paper outlines biological immune system mechanism and theoretical basis and introduces the basic principle and method of artificial immune system. This paper gives an in-depth analysis and research on the self-organization antibody network and carries out the simulation of pattern recognition using standard data set. The method is used to power transformer fault analysis based on transformer oil and gas analysis data. The simulation results show that the method is feasible and effective.This paper introduces the design of transformer fault diagnosis system based on artificial immune technology using Visual C++for module development and structure design. The system mainly completes transformer fault diagnosis function.
